Sankt Georg
Sankt Georg is a locality in Neubrandenburg, Mecklenburgische Seenplatte,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ania. Sankt Georg is situated nearby to the suburb Südstadt, as well as near Brodaer Höhe.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Camp Fünfeichen
Locality
Photo: Bwbuz,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Camp Fünfeichen was a World War II German prisoner-of-war camp located in Fünfeichen, a former estate within the city limits of Neubrandenburg, Mecklenburg, northern Germany. Camp Fünfeichen is situated 4 km southeast of Sankt Georg.
